A practical well arranged three bedroom detached property situated in the heart of Kingsdown, enjoying a sunny level south-easterly facing rear garden and a garage.Inspired by Scandinavian architecture, this well located 1970s two storey home offers balanced and well configured accommodation with plenty of natural light.Incredibly convenient location, close to local shops and eateries of St Michael’s Hill and Cotham Hill.Whiteladies Road with it’s bus connections, cinema and Clifton Down train station are also within easy reach, as are excellent schools including Cotham Gardens Primary, Cotham Secondary and Bristol Grammar School.Ground Floor: Entrance hallway, through lounge/dining room with separate kitchen, ground floor cloakroom/wc.First Floor: Landing, all bedrooms and a family bathroom.Outside: Level south-easterly facing garden and a single garage in a nearby block. An incredibly centrally located house with a light and airy interior and exciting scope for some further updating.
